An Executive Certificate in Computer Vision for Surgical Procedures provides specialized training in applying cutting-edge computer vision techniques to the medical field. This program equips participants with the skills to analyze medical images, develop algorithms for image processing, and contribute to innovations in minimally invasive surgery and robotic surgery.
Learning outcomes include mastering image segmentation, object detection, and 3D reconstruction relevant to surgical applications. Students will gain proficiency in using deep learning frameworks for medical image analysis and develop a strong understanding of the ethical considerations and regulatory aspects surrounding the use of AI in healthcare. The curriculum integrates hands-on projects and case studies to ensure practical application of learned concepts.
The program's duration typically ranges from a few months to a year, depending on the intensity and course load.
